Unifying, Subtracting, and Intersecting Entities Example (C#)
This example shows how to perform union, subtract, and intersect operations
on 3D solids.
//--------------------------------------------------------------
// Preconditions:
// 1. Create a C# Windows console project.
// 2. Copy and paste this example into the C# IDE.
// 3. Add a reference to:
// install_dir\APISDK\tlb\DraftSight.Interop.dsAutomation.dll
// 4. Start DraftSight.
// 5. Press F5 to debug the project.
//
// Postconditions:
// 1. Inserts 2D polylines and creates 3D
polysolids from them.
// 2. Performs union, subtract, and
intersect operations on the 3D polysolids.
// 3. Inspect the graphics area.
//----------------------------------------------------------------
